There are times that dogs can amaze us with the things that they do. Sometimes, they get stuck in places where they can’t find an exit. This is what exactly happened to a Spaniel/Terrier mix named Teazle from Dorset.
Teazle was known to be very adventurous. On May 8th, Teazle and her mom, Clare Tredea, went for a stroll in the woods of Delcombe. It wasn’t that long when Clare noticed that her pup was missing since she usually let Treazle and her two other dogs roam around.
Clare mentioned that her pup was chasing squirrels. She also said that it’s not very usual for Teazle to run far since this pup has short legs. She started to get worried when her pup still wasn’t with her when she got at the top of the drive.
Clare’s family looked for the poor pup in the place where they stayed. There were no roads nearby, so they didn’t think someone had caught Teazle. None of the family members saw their fur baby.
The fear of Teazle’s family doubled when they got home without their pup. Clare slept on the kitchen floor, hoping that Teazle would come home anytime soon.
It was at 5 am the next morning when they started to search again – every possible place that their pup might be. Soon after, Jack, Clare’s son, saw eyes from a tree root. And there she was! Teazle got stuck in a tree root for almost 24 hours! Funny how the family haven’t noticed her even though they searched all over the place.
Since Teazle got stuck in a black hole, you couldn’t see her from any other angle besides at the top of the tree root. It was pure luck when Jack stood at the right place where Teazle is. Jack called Teazle the luckiest dog ever.
The poor pup got stuck firmly in a root shaped like a letter U. Clare thought that maybe Teazle was chasing after a squirrel and accidentally got trapped inside the tree root. It was a tough night for the poor pup.
It took 45 minutes for the family to rescue Teazle by sawing the thick root away. Emma, Jack’s girlfriend, distracted Teazle by speaking to her while protecting the poor pup’s head. Soon after, they were able to lift Teazle out of the tree. If they were not able to see where Teazle is, she might haven’t been able to survive and start to call the tree Teazle’s tomb.
It was a relief when they got Teazle home safe and sound. Luck had come into Jack’s way when he stood right at the top of the tree root. Clare added to be more observant in looking for missing pups.
